After ignoring his pleas to pull over, Card punched him in the face, Hodgson said. “The Anxious Generation” neglects these subtleties when, for example, it discusses a brain system known as the default mode network. This system decreases in activity when we engage with spirituality, meditation and related endeavors, and Haidt uses this fact to claim that social media is “not healthy for any of us” because studies suggest that it by contrast increases activity in the same network. In other words, an association between increased brain activity and using social media could mean that social media activates the identified pathways, or people who already have increased activity in those pathways tend to be drawn to social media, or both. Cruise the Hudson round-trip from New York City on American Cruise Lines' seven-night Hudson River Fall Foliage Cruise. You'll visit Catskill, home to the Hudson River School Art Trail and the Olana Historic Site, or explore more actively at the Hudson River Skywalk and Kaaterskill Falls. In Albany, founded in 1609, you can tour the newly renovated New York State Capitol building, built in the late 1800s; you can also visit the New York State Museum, which dates to 1836.

Cruising is a popular vacation option for millions of travelers around the world in large part because of its convenience. Travelers stay in one room for the entire trip while the boat travels from port to port. Cruisers enjoy lots of world-class amenities like restaurants, shows and water activities on board, and they also have the option to disembark and sightsee or participate in excursions when the ship docks. Before you buy a cruise, you’ll be well-served by understanding how these vacations work, what is and isn’t included in the fare and what it might cost to insure your trip in case the worst were to happen. As a rule, interior, windowless cabins are the least expensive, while cabins with ocean-view balconies are the priciest. Additionally, larger cabins and extra perks like early boarding usually come at a higher cost.

The other perks included in your cruise fare will depend on how much you pay; many larger cruise lines offer multiple tiers of fares. The lowest tier will be the cheapest, but you should expect to pay out of pocket for extras like drinks, certain restaurant meals and activities and excursions once you’re on board.
